What it is

Acetyl Tetrapeptide-3 is a synthetic biomimetic peptide used in cosmetic formulations, often marketed to support hair anchoring, follicle health, and extracellular matrix proteins. It is also included in some skincare products for its purported effects on dermal matrix and skin firmness.

Side effects reported in research

Reported effectHow oftenNotes
Mild skin irritation or redness
RareGenerally well tolerated; transient irritation possible in sensitive individuals.
Contact allergic reaction
Very rareIsolated reports; peptides are considered low-sensitizing.
Localized itching or stinging
RareUsually formulation-dependent rather than peptide-specific.

Frequencies reflect typical cosmetic use reported in the literature, not a guarantee for your skin.
